    Position Summary

    East Texas A&M University Athletics is seeking qualified Graduate Assistants to support the daily operations of NCAA Division I sport programs. Graduate Assistants will assist coaches and athletics administrators with the administrative, operational, and organizational functions of an assigned sport while gaining valuable experience in collegiate athletics. Responsibilities will vary based on the needs of the assigned program and may include team operations, student-athlete support, event preparation, travel coordination, recruiting support, equipment management, and other administrative duties.
